Thursday-4-July
Ridgefield Park, NJ
The Village of Ridgefield Park will hold their 130th Fourth of July Celebration
-7:30a there will be a reading of the Decoration of Independence at the Memorial Plaza. This will be followed by the raising of the Pearl Harbor American Flag.
-8:00a the Ridgefield Park Volunteer Fire Department will have a review of the Officers and Equipment at the Firefighter Memorial. Both will be held on Euclid Ave.
-9:00a the Baby and Youth Parade will start. This will begin at the corner of Popular St. and Euclid Ave.
-11:00a the Main Civic Parade will start at Preston St. and Hudson Ave. It will move to Main St. and end at Brinkerhoff St.
-3:00p the Northern New Jersy Youth Jazz Orchestra will perform at the Overpeck Park Amphitheater.
-7:30p the Rutherford Community Band will perform in Biggs Stadium
About 9:15p Mr. Robert Bannon will sing the National Anthem followed by the Ridgefield Park Fireworks show.
After Ridgefield Park Fireworks are over the Bergen County Fire Work show will take place. The Public is welcomed to stay in Biggs Stadium to view the fireworks form Overpeck Park.
